The Environmental, Health, and Safety (EH&S) Manager will report to the Head or Associate Director of EH&S and serve as a key member of the EH&S Leadership Team. This role is responsible for fostering a strong safety culture and ensuring compliance with all applicable local and regional regulations. The EH&S Manager will collaborate closely with staff at the Covington, GA site and other locations as needed to implement and uphold company-wide safety and health policies.

This position will lead the development and execution of comprehensive EH&S programs and initiatives, including but not limited to: contractor and construction safety, industrial hygiene, chemical management, Lock-Out-Tag-Out (LOTO), confined space entry, powered industrial trucks, electrical safety, hazard communication, DOT dangerous goods, warehouse and laboratory safety, chemical hygiene, hearing conservation, and environmental sustainability.

The EH&S Manager will also provide general project management support and act as a liaison with subject matter experts across departments to drive compliance, reduce risk, and support continuous improvement efforts across the facility.

How You Will Contribute

  • Lead, manage, and coach the EH&S team to develop and implement Core and Technical Safety initiatives that support site operations efficiently and on schedule.

  • Oversee the design and execution of safety programs that ensure safe, compliant, and effective operation of critical systems.

  • Administer the Industrial Hygiene (IH) program, including testing, protocol development, and implementation of a risk-based IH strategy.

  • Deliver environmental and sustainability programs, including air emissions, stormwater, wastewater, pollution prevention, hazardous waste management, and required environmental reporting.

  • Manage the Process Safety Management (PSM) program, including Process Hazard Analysis (PHA), Management of Change (MOC), and Mechanical Integrity (MI).

  • Act as the tactical liaison between EH&S and site expansion or construction projects, collaborating with project sponsors and support teams.

  • Serve as the EH&S representative supporting the site's functional business units.

  • Continuously enhance the risk assessment process to proactively identify and mitigate enterprise-level risks.

  • Lead and participate in investigations, addressing compliance concerns and resolving regulatory questions.

  • Support the development and implementation of the site's EHS Management System.

  • Collaborate cross-functionally with Manufacturing, QC Labs, Critical Systems, Maintenance, and Engineering to ensure compliance with federal, state, local, and company EH&S requirements.

  • Partner with Corporate EH&S to implement global initiatives and align site practices with enterprise standards.

  • Serve as an active member of the site's Emergency Response Team (ERT), responding to emergencies within your level of training, including CPR, First Aid, AED use, and chemical spill response with SCBA.
